Dear all,
I specify the inlet velocity for a multiphase system ( one liquid and two granular solids) but when I simulate I find that the pressure is not uniform across the cross-section of the inlet. Could anybody say why is it so. thanx sm |

If you have a viscous flow, pressure does not have to be uniform and in general is not uniform. If you have a uniform velocity inlet it is unlikely to be uniform.
